Output 26baba1c9ff60f748dfa64a1cc9437106a5e04ca0782d2bf64b2f33384a67a0f:1

value
8883000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c57788ff027704a065f4ef1458b7a53b01b99655 OP_EQUAL
address
3Kh8EnHQp3bBeHU2AKbYuys88joT8hy37H
transaction
26baba1c9ff60f748dfa64a1cc9437106a5e04ca0782d2bf64b2f33384a67a0f
spent
true